Rockville, In vs Jakarta, Java Climate & Distance Between

Indonesia flag
  • The distance between Rockville, In, Usa and Jakarta, Java, Indonesia is approximately 16,009 km or 9,948 mi.
  • To reach Rockville, In in this distance one would set out from Jakarta, Java bearing 18.1° or NNE and follow the great circles arc to approach Rockville, In bearing 156.2° or SSE .
  • Rockville, In has a hot summer continental climate with no dry season (Dfa) whereas Jakarta, Java has a tropical monsoonal climate (Am).
  • Rockville, In is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ome whereas Jakarta, Java is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
  • The annual average temperature is 16 °C (28.8°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 26.1 °C (47°F) more in Rockville, In.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to extremely h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 654.8 mm (25.8 in) less which is equivalent to 654.8 l/m² (16.07 US gal/ft²) or 6,548,000 l/ha (700,025 US gal/ac) less. About 5/8 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 23.9° lower in Rockville, In than in Jakarta, Java.
